How Our Commercial Water Damage Restoration Process Works

We understand that a proper process is crucial in restoring your property to its pre-loss condition. Our team follows a step-by-step approach to ensure that every aspect of the restoration is handled with care and attention to detail. When corners are cut, the risk of further damage and costly repairs increases. Trust our team to do it right the first time.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ll assess the damage and develop a customized plan to restore your property. This includes identifying the source of the water, evaluating the extent of the damage, and determining the necessary equipment and personnel to complete the job.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that our plan meets your needs and budget.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ll extract the water using industrial-grade pumps and equipment, reducing the risk of further damage and promoting a safe working environment. Our team will work efficiently to remove as much water as possible, ensuring that your property is dry and ready for the next step.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ll dry out your property using specialized equipment and techniques, including dehumidification and air movement. This step is critical in preventing further damage and promoting a healthy environment for occupants.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ll clean and sanitize all affected areas, including carpets, upholstery, and hard surfaces.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ment for your property and occupants.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

We’ll restore and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, and floors. Our team will work closely with you to ensure that the final result meets your expectations and exceeds your standards.

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the warning signs of water damage, and don’t wait until it’s too late.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of water damage, especially if they persist even after cleaning and disinfecting. Don’t ignore these odors, as they can show the presence of mold and bacteria.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by other signs like discoloration or peeling.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age, especially if they’re accompanied by other signs like warping or discoloration. Don’t ignore these stains, as they can show the presence of hidden water dam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by other signs like warping or discoloration.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Discolored or Fading Carpet

Discolored or fading carpet can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by other signs like warping or peeling.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can show the presence of hidden water damage.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of water damage, especially if they’re accompanied by other signs like warping or discoloration.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ost in Covington, LA

Prices for commercial water damage restoration can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Covington, LA.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can serve as a rough guide for your budgeting purposes.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ed.
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
Emergency Response $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age and equipment needed.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to help you budget for your commercial water damage restoration needs.
